41644-17-1,41644-24-0,307352-83-6,339154-54-0,41278-56-2,41278-58-4 Supplier | CHEMEXPLORE.CN
CMO CDMO service. CHEMEXPLORE.CN supply 41644-17-1,41644-24-0,307352-83-6,339154-54-0,41278-56-2,41278-58-4 and related compounds.
339154-54-0 307352-83-6 41644-17-1 41278-56-2 41278-58-4 41644-24-0